What is eSIM in Boston (Pennsylvania), United States?
An eSIM, short for embedded SIM, is a small chip built into your phone or tablet. It replaces the traditional plastic SIM card and lets you connect to mobile networks in Boston (Pennsylvania), United States without inserting anything into your device.

How does eSIM work in Boston (Pennsylvania), United States?
At its core, eSIM works almost the same way as a traditional SIM card used in United States. The main difference is how it is installed.
Instead of inserting a card, you download an eSIM profile from a provider that supports United States and Boston (Pennsylvania). After selecting a prepaid plan for United States, your phone connects to the local mobile network in Boston (Pennsylvania) without any physical changes.

Keep your existing phone number while in Boston (Pennsylvania), United States
Using an eSIM in United States lets you keep your main phone number while using mobile data in Boston (Pennsylvania). Your physical SIM stays in your phone, and the eSIM handles the data connection while you are in Boston (Pennsylvania).
This is useful if you still want to receive calls, messages, or verification codes while staying in Boston (Pennsylvania), United States.
